Output c9584fedae7939f9d6068407c6221de5c7138d471dd6bb3e2302d615603e59e4:36

value
2823154
script pubkey
OP_0 OP_PUSHBYTES_20 2be5817cdb190cdd658ba954cbf8b5757f0c9f89
address
bc1q90jczlxmryxd6evt492vh794w4lse8ufdj424y
transaction
c9584fedae7939f9d6068407c6221de5c7138d471dd6bb3e2302d615603e59e4
spent
true